Spontaneous soliton formation and modulational instability in Bose-Einstein condensates | L. D. Carr
; J. Brand
; | Date: |
13 Mar 2003 | Journal: | Phys. Rev. Lett. 92, 040401 (2004) | Subject: | Soft Condensed Matter; Pattern Formation and Solitons | cond-mat.soft nlin.PS | Abstract: | The dynamics of an elongated attractive Bose-Einstein condensate in an axisymmetric harmonic trap is studied. It is shown that density fringes caused by self-interference of the condensate order parameter seed modulational instability. The latter has novel features in contradistinction to the usual homogeneous case known from nonlinear fiber optics. Several open questions in the interpretation of the recent creation of the first matter-wave bright soliton train [Strecker {it et al.} Nature {f 417} 150 (2002)] are addressed. It is shown that primary transverse collapse, followed by secondary collapse induced by soliton--soliton interactions, produce bursts of hot atoms at different time scales. | Source: | arXiv, cond-mat/0303257 | Services: | Forum | Review | PDF | Favorites |
